Euro Truck Simulator 2 is a milestone update that introduced community-requested features alongside significant visual and technical overhauls. Core Gameplay Features Used Truck Dealers
: Players can now purchase pre-owned trucks directly from the main menu. These budget-friendly vehicles feature realistic mileage and wear , which is represented by a star rating system. Enhanced Damage & Repair System
: The update replaced the simplistic damage model with a three-stage system: Normal Damage : Standard repairs for immediate issues. : Gradual degradation requiring eventual replacement. Permanent Wear
: Long-term aging of the vehicle that requires a full restoration to fix. Keybind Modifiers : You can now bind actions to a combination of keys (e.g., for lights) and distinguish between short and long presses Automatic Headlights
: A new convenience feature that triggers headlights based on ambient light levels. SCS Software's blog Visual & Atmospheric Updates HDR Skyboxes & Moon
: Skyboxes are now High Dynamic Range (HDR), providing richer colors. The Moon has been fully integrated with realistic rendering of lunar light and reflections. Improved Weather Performance Tips for v1
